Search a number
-
+
21003371 is a prime number
BaseRepresentation
bin101000000011…
…1110001101011
31110112002012122
41100013301223
520334101441
62030101455
7343345214
oct120076153
943462178
1021003371
1110946164
12704a88b
13447503c
142b0a40b
151c9d34b
hex1407c6b

21003371 has 2 divisors, whose sum is σ = 21003372. Its totient is φ = 21003370.

The previous prime is 21003349. The next prime is 21003373. The reversal of 21003371 is 17330012.

It is a strong prime.

It is a cyclic number.

It is a de Polignac number, because none of the positive numbers 2k-21003371 is a prime.

It is a super-2 number, since 2×210033712 = 882283186727282, which contains 22 as substring.

Together with 21003373, it forms a pair of twin primes.

It is a Chen prime.

It is not a weakly prime, because it can be changed into another prime (21003373) by changing a digit.

It is a polite number, since it can be written as a sum of consecutive naturals, namely, 10501685 + 10501686.

It is an arithmetic number, because the mean of its divisors is an integer number (10501686).

Almost surely, 221003371 is an apocalyptic number.

21003371 is a deficient number, since it is larger than the sum of its proper divisors (1).

21003371 is an equidigital number, since it uses as much as digits as its factorization.

21003371 is an evil number, because the sum of its binary digits is even.

The product of its (nonzero) digits is 126, while the sum is 17.

The square root of 21003371 is about 4582.9434864506. The cubic root of 21003371 is about 275.9071792822.

Adding to 21003371 its reverse (17330012), we get a palindrome (38333383).

The spelling of 21003371 in words is "twenty-one million, three thousand, three hundred seventy-one".